Transaction 43fe4976216b2673824c8819ed46d6b8e1bd34eb3e8d4b7bc7f0e643d4a316c4

1 Input
2 Outputs
  • 43fe4976216b2673824c8819ed46d6b8e1bd34eb3e8d4b7bc7f0e643d4a316c4:0
  • value  30159979
    address  1HMdD2dPhbU61uM4gSfpEWRfa8Ej3JykKR
  • 43fe4976216b2673824c8819ed46d6b8e1bd34eb3e8d4b7bc7f0e643d4a316c4:1
  • value  717793
    address  1CrEzSWQpukhPFHcWKidVc9HEHuoU1Zuxv